Ajax’s Tactical Outlook: Returning to Familiar Faces
Under the management of Spanish coach Míchel, Ajax has demonstrated a flexible and strategic approach, adjusting lineups to maximize team strengths and adapt to the challenges posed by their opponents. The midweek clash against Willem II saw the Dutch giants secure a commanding 5-1 victory, showcasing their attacking prowess and tactical discipline. However, for this upcoming match against Excelsior, Míchel appears poised to revert to a lineup that has served him well in previous fixtures, emphasizing experience and stability.
Starting goalkeeper Marc-André ter Stegen is expected to don the goalkeeping gloves once again, providing a reliable last line of defense. In defense, Anton Gaaei steps in at right-back, replacing Lucas Rosa, who was part of the midweek squad. The central defensive pairing will feature Thilo Kehrer and Youri Baas, offering a blend of experience and composure to withstand Excelsior’s attacking threats. On the left flank, Caio Henrique replaces Wijndal, adding fresh energy and defensive stability.
Midfield and Attack: Balancing Creativity and Strength
Ajax’s midfield setup continues to be a crucial element of their tactical approach. Davy Klaassen and Julian Brandt are expected to retain their starting roles, providing creativity, vision, and the ability to link defense and attack smoothly. The return of Sofyan Amrabat at the base of midfield adds steel and resilience, allowing the team to control possession and disrupt Excelsior’s build-up play. Notably, Jorthy Mokio will likely drop out, making room for Amrabat’s dynamic presence.
Up front, Tolu Arokodare is set to lead the line once again after being called up by Nigeria, bringing physicality and goal-scoring threat. Supporting him on the wings are Steven Berghuis on the right and Oscar Gloukh on the left. Gloukh’s creativity and pace could be pivotal in unlocking Excelsior’s defense, while Berghuis’s experience and leadership will be vital in orchestrating offensive moves.
